This big range shows that the technology can be used in many ways and that healthcare groups are slowly becoming more interested. The economic benefits come from several main areas:<\/p>\n<ul>\n<li><b>Reducing administrative costs:<\/b> Healthcare spends a lot of money on tasks like writing down patient visits, answering phone calls, and handling records. Generative AI can do these routine jobs, which helps hospitals and clinics spend less money on daily operations.<\/li>\n<li><b>Enhancing clinical efficiency:<\/b> AI helps doctors and nurses write clinical notes and summarize patient info. This lets them spend more time taking care of patients. As a result, patients may feel more satisfied and clinics can treat more people.<\/li>\n<li><b>Supporting value-based care:<\/b> AI helps make care plans that rely on good data. These plans aim to give better care based on each patient\u2019s needs. AI can spot risks early and suggest personalized treatments. This helps patients get better and means fewer hospital readmissions, saving money for both payers and providers.<\/li>\n<li><b>Expanding AI-driven diagnostics and analytics:<\/b> AI is used more to predict health risks and improve diagnosis. Big healthcare companies like Epic use AI to analyze data and reduce errors. Improved Patient Safety and Accuracy<\/h2>\n<p>Some groups like Austin Health are working to prove that generative AI can be used safely. Experts like John Moehrke point out it\u2019s important to clearly show which parts come from AI. This means AI notes or advice should not be mixed up with what doctors or patients say. Clear labeling helps keep trust in medical records and decisions.<\/p>\n<h2>2. Enhanced Interoperability Across Systems<\/h2>\n<p>Healthcare often has many separate data systems, making it hard to share patient info smoothly. Generative AI, when used with standards like Clinical Quality Language (CQL), can help connect these systems better. This means doctors and other care providers can work together more easily and give patients more consistent, personalized care.<\/p>\n<h2>3. Healthcare leaders and IT teams should think about these before using AI.<\/p>\n<h2>Data Privacy and Security<\/h2>\n<p>Health data is very private, and AI needs this data to work well. In the U.S., laws like HIPAA require strict protection of patient info. AI tools must follow these rules to keep data safe and patients\u2019 trust.<\/p>\n<h2>Transparency and Bias<\/h2>\n<p>AI can have bias if it\u2019s trained on limited or uneven data. Experts say AI tools need to be made fairly and checked often. Being clear about how AI works helps doctors and administrators trust the results and make good decisions.<\/p>\n<h2>Human Oversight<\/h2>\n<p>Experts warn against letting AI make all clinical decisions by itself. AI should help doctors, not replace them. Healthcare workers must review AI results to avoid mistakes and keep responsibility for patient care.<\/p>\n<h2>Integration Complexity<\/h2>\n<p>Adding AI into healthcare systems is often tricky. Many hospitals use different electronic health records and software.
